Angled Triple Tower
This fantastic play structure will inspire young children to play again and again, stimulating their physical, social and thinking skills. Their muscle and motor skills come in full use, climbing to the top and sliding or gliding in a rotating movement to the ground. The bubble window in the tunnel bridge distorts voices when spoken into, evoking a sense of wonder and training logical thinking. Sliding down the slide or curly climber to the ground supports posture and balance, all important skills for young children, and great fun! Under deck, a wealth of manipulative play panels stimulate explorative and dramatic play. The panels support logical thinking skills and cooperation.

Each play activity represents a type of play experience, such as balancing, social interaction, climbing, or sensory exploration. The number indicates how many opportunities the product offers for children to engage in that activity. Together, these activities help create a varied and developmentally rich play experience.

The overall framework applied for these factors is the Environmental Product Declaration (EPD), which quantifies "environmental information on the life cycle of a product and enables comparisons between products fulfilling the same function" (ISO, 2006). This follows the structure and applies a Life-Cycle Assessment approach to the entire Product stage from raw material through manufacturing (A1-A3).
